Output d9336b4befa10737f9019db10dd22d1f8893058167e76ff35695dd9da574a72a:9

value
40503660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87200d72a4f9d7f40c159cafe804947a67c239d OP_EQUALVERIFY OP_CHECKSIG
address
1HpFuPG2YreV2rpUy4ZCw3Quwkhh14Q9RK
transaction
d9336b4befa10737f9019db10dd22d1f8893058167e76ff35695dd9da574a72a
confirmations
544962
spent
true